Dash is a self-service tool for researchers to describe, upload, and share their research data. It is designed to be a simple self-service curation tool for researchers, and helps them perform the following tasks:
- Prepare data for curation by reviewing best practice guidance for the creation or acquisition of digital research data.
- Select data for curation through local file browse or drag-and-drop operation.
- Describe data in terms of the DataCite metadata schema.
- Identify data with a persistent digital object identifier (DOI) for permanent citation and discovery.
- Preserve, manage, and share data by uploading to a public Merritt repository collection.
- Discover and retrieve data through faceted search and browse.
